Technical datasheet

MAPICO™ Yellow 2150

Supplied byVenator Materials- Last Updated on May 20, 2020

Ferric oxide hydrate (FeOOH) manufactured in the martin process that is suitable for use in plastic applications. Is a permanent, non-bleeding inert pigment with a clean shade and good heat resistance that can be dispersed in plastics, and other applications. Used alone and in combination with organic pigments to improve opacity, reduce formula cost and add UV resistance. Meets or exceeds ASTM C979-82 standards for color pigments used in cement. Recommended, owing to its sufficient purity, to be used as a colorant in cosmetic, animal and pet food applications and in packaging or articles that come in contact with food (21CFR). Offers reliability and consistent quality, stability under exposure to sunlight and UV radiation, and alkali, chemical and weather resistancy. Suggested for rubber and plastics applications.
